How to pass variables and data from PHP to JavaScript ?

In this article, let’s see how to pass data and variables from PHP to JavaScript.

We can pass data from PHP to JavaScript in two ways depending on the situation. First, we can pass the data using the simple assignment operator if we want to perform the operation on the same page. Else we can pass data from PHP to JavaScript using Cookies. Cookie work in client-side.

Program 1: This program passes the variables and data from PHP to JavaScript using assignment operator.

How to pass variables and data from PHP to JavaScript?

GeeksforGeeks

How to pass variables and data from PHP to JavaScript? $name = "Hello World" ; document.write(x);

Output:

Here, we just take input by statically or dynamically and pass it to JavaScript variable using the assignment operator. The PHP code in the JavaScript block will convert it into the resulting output and then pass it to the variable x and then the value of x is printed.

Program 2: This program passes the variables and data from PHP to JavaScript using Cookies.

How to pass variables and data from PHP to JavaScript?

GeeksforGeeks

How to pass variables and data from PHP to JavaScript? // Initialize cookie name $cookie_name = "user" ; $cookie_value = "raj" ; // Set cookie setcookie( $cookie_name , $cookie_value ); if (!isset( $_COOKIES [ $cookie_name ])) < print ( "Cookie created | " ); var x = document.cookie; document.write(x);

Output:

PHP provides a method to set the cookie using the setCookie() method. Here, we can set the data or variable in PHP cookie and retrieve it from JavaScript using document.cookie.

Steps to Run the program:

PHP is a server-side scripting language designed specifically for web development. You can learn PHP from the ground up by following this PHP Tutorial and PHP Examples.

Like Article -->

Please Login to comment.

Similar Reads

How to pass JavaScript variables to PHP ?

JavaScript is the client side and PHP is the server-side script language. The way to pass a JavaScript variable to PHP is through a request. Below are the methods to pass JavaScript variables to PHP: Table of Content Using GET/POST methodUsing Cookies to store informationUsing AJAXUsing GET/POST methodThis example uses the form element and GET/POST

3 min read Pass by Value and Pass by Reference in Javascript

JavaScript, being a versatile and dynamic programming language, employs different strategies for passing variables to functions. Two common approaches are "pass by value" and "pass by reference". Understanding these concepts is important for writing efficient and bug-free code. Pass By ValueWhen a function is called, the value of the variable is di

4 min read How to pass PHP Variables by reference ?

By default, PHP variables are passed by value as the function arguments in PHP. When variables in PHP is passed by value, the scope of the variable defined at function level bound within the scope of function. Changing either of the variables doesn't have any effect on either of the variables. Example: <?php // Function used for assigning new //

2 min read How to pass form variables from one page to other page in PHP ?

Form is an HTML element used to collect information from the user in a sequential and organized manner. This information can be sent to the back-end services if required by them, or it can also be stored in a database using DBMS like MySQL. Splitting a form into multiple steps or pages allow better data handling and layering of information. This ca

4 min read How to Pass variables to JavaScript in Express JS ?

Express is a lightweight framework that sits on top of Node.js’s web server functionality to simplify its APIs and add helpful new features. It makes it easier to organize your application’s functionality with middleware and routing. When working with Express.js you may encounter scenarios where you need to pass variables from your server-side code

2 min read How to pass variables to the next middleware using next() in Express.js ?

The following example covers how to pass variables to the next middleware using next() in Express.js. Approach: We cannot directly pass data to the next middleware, but we can send data through the request object. [Middleware 1] [Middleware 2] request.mydata = someData; -------> let dataFromMiddleware1 = request.mydata; Installation of Express m

2 min read How to Pass JSON Data in a URL using CURL in PHP ?

In this article, we will see how to pass the JSON Data in a URL using CURL in PHP, along with understanding the different ways for passing the data in a URL through the illustrations. The cURL stands for client URL, which allows us to connect with other URLs & use their responses in our code, i.e., it is a tool for sending and getting files usi

7 min read How to pass a PHP array to a JavaScript function?

Passing PHP Arrays to JavaScript is very easy by using JavaScript Object Notation(JSON). Method 1: Using json_encode() function: The json_encode() function is used to return the JSON representation of a value or array. The function can take both single dimensional and multidimensional arrays. Steps: Creating an array in PHP: <?php$sampleArray =

3 min read React.js Blueprint Variables Font variables

In this article, we will learn about the Font Variables offered by the blueprint.js library. BlueprintJS is a React-based UI toolkit for the web. It is written in Typescript. This library is very optimized and popular for building interfaces that are complex and data-dense for desktop applications that run in a modern web browser. Font Variables: T

3 min read Less.js Variables Default Variables

LESS (Leaner Style Sheets) is a simple CSS pre-processor that facilitates the creation of manageable, customizable, and reusable style sheets for websites. It is a dynamic style sheet language that enhances the working power of CSS. LESS supports cross-browser compatibility. CSS pre-processor is a scripting language that improves CSS and gets compi

3 min read Less.js Variables Properties as Variables

LESS (Leaner Style Sheets) is a simple CSS pre-processor that facilitates the creation of manageable, customizable, and reusable style sheets for websites. It is a dynamic style sheet language that enhances the working power of CSS. LESS supports cross-browser compatibility. CSS pre-processor is a scripting language that improves CSS and gets compi

3 min read How to pass both form data and credentials on submit in ajax ?

The purpose of this article is to send the form data and credentials to the PHP backend using AJAX in an HTML document. Approach: Create a form in an HTML document with a submit button and assign an id to that button. In JavaScript, the file adds an event listener to the form's submit button i.e. click. Then the request is made to a PHP file using

2 min read How to Pass an Array into a Function in PHP ?

This article will show you how to pass an array to function in PHP. When working with arrays, it is essential to understand how to pass them into functions for effective code organization and re-usability. This article explores various approaches to pass arrays into PHP functions, covering different methods and scenarios. Table of Content Passing b

2 min read Pass data between components using Vue.js Event Bus

Component communication in Vue.js can become complicated and messy at times using $emit and props. In real-world applications where the Component tree is nested and big, it is not convenient to pass data using this method as it will only increase the complexity of the application and make debugging very tedious. This is where an event bus comes int

3 min read How to pass multiple JSON Objects as data using jQuery's $.ajax() ?

The purpose of this article is to pass multiple JSON objects as data using the jQuery $ajax() method in an HTML document. Approach: Create a button in an HTML document to send JSON objects to a PHP server. In the JavaScript file, add a click event listener to the button. On clicking of the button, a request is made to PHP file using jQuery $ajax()

3 min read How to pass data from one component to other component in ReactJS ?

In React, passing data from one component to another component is a common task. It helps build a dynamic and interactive web application. We can pass data in components from parent to child, child to parent, and between siblings as shown below. Table of ContentPassing data from Parent to ChildPassing data from Child to Parent ComponentPassing data

5 min read Pass Data Between Siblings in Angular

In Angular, components are the building blocks of the user interface. If the structure of components is hierarchical, passing data between parent and child components is simple using input/output bindings. However, passing data directly between sibling components can be more challenging since they don't have a direct parent-child relationship. Tabl

5 min read How to Pass Data into a Bootstrap Modal?

Bootstrap along with HTML and JavaScript can be used to build responsive web pages. A modal is a popup or dialog box that requires some action to be performed. A modal. Bootstrap has an inbuilt modal component. The modal consists of two parts the modal header and the modal body. Data can be passed to the modal body from the HTML document which gets

3 min read How to pass data to a React Bootstrap modal?

In React Bootstrap, we have the styling and interactive components of Modal. In simple terms, Modal is nothing but the popup box that is opened when some action has been performed. To make the modal customizable in terms of its behavior, we can pass the custom data to the React Bootstrap modal using state variables and also by using the props in Re

4 min read How to pass data into table from a form using React Components ?

React JS is a front-end library used to build UI components. This article will help to learn to pass data into a table from a form using React Components. This will be done using two React components named Table and Form. We will enter data into a form, which will be displayed in the table on 'submit'. Prerequisites:Node JS or NPMReact JSReact Form

3 min read How to pass data from Parent to Child component in Angular ?

We can use the @Input directive for passing the data from the Parent to Child component in Angular Using Input Binding: @Input - We can use this directive inside the child component to access the data sent by the parent component. Here app.component is the Parent component and cdetail.component is the child component. Parent Componentapp.component.

3 min read How to Pass Data from Child Component to its Parent in ReactJS ?

To pass the data from child to parent we will utilize the react's unidirectional data flow. it means data is passed from parent components to child components. Here instead of passing data to child we will pass a function that sends the data back to the parent. ApproachTo pass data from the child to the parent component: Define Callback: First, cre

2 min read How to pass image as a parameter in JavaScript function ?

We all are familiar with functions and their parameters and we often use strings, integers, objects, and arrays as a parameter in JavaScript functions but now will see how to pass an image as a parameter in the JavaScript functions. We will use vanilla JavaScript here. Approach: First, create a function that receives a parameter and then calls that

2 min read How to pass primitive/object types through functions in JavaScript ?

In this article, we learn how JavaScript primitive/object types passed through functions. First, we will see, what are primitive and object data types in JavaScript: 1. Primitive data type: The predefined data types that are provided by JavaScript are called primitive data type. The primitive data types in JavaScript are: String: A String is a coll

4 min read How to pass value to execute multiple conditions in JavaScript ?

In this article, we will try to understand how we can pass certain values in multiple conditions in JavaScript with the help of certain coding examples. The term, multiple conditionals, actually refer to more than one conditionals in number. This would eventually include the usage of "if-elseif-else" or switch statement. We can also use special fun

3 min read JavaScript Program to Pass Parameter to a setTimeout() Method

In this article, we will discuss how to pass parameters to the setTimeout() method in JavaScript. The setTimeout() method is used to delay the execution of a piece of code. This method executes a function, after waiting a specified number of milliseconds. We have different approaches to passing parameters to the setTimeout() method. There are sever

3 min read JavaScript Pass string parameter in onClick function

In JavaScript, you can pass a string parameter in an onClick function by enclosing the function call in an anonymous function. In this article, we will see how to Pass string parameters in the onClick function. Example 1: This example simply puts the argument which is a string in the onClick attribute of the button which calls a function with a str

2 min read Pass by Value in JavaScript

In JavaScript, the concept of "pass by value" explains how arguments are passed to functions. When primitive data types (like numbers, strings, and booleans) are passed as function arguments, the actual value is copied into the parameter inside the function. Changes made to the parameter inside the function do not affect the original value outside

1 min read What is Pass by Value in JavaScript ?

In JavaScript, pass-by value refers to the mechanism by which arguments are passed to functions. When primitive data types (like numbers, strings, or booleans) are passed as arguments, a copy of the actual value is passed to the function. Changes made to the parameter inside the function do not affect the original value outside the function. This b

1 min read Pass by Reference in JavaScript ?

Contrary to common belief, JavaScript is not a pass-by-reference language but Instead, it is a pass-by-value for all its variable passing. In JavaScript, when an object is passed as an argument to a function a reference to the object is passed not a direct copy of the object itself. The modifications made to the object's properties within the funct